Big Data Analytics for Early Detection and Prevention of Age-Related Diseases in Elderly Healthcare

Mohd Amran Mohd Daril,
Shazia Qayuum,
Alhamzah F. Abbas
et al.

Abstract: The exponential growth of the elderly population poses considerable obstacles to healthcare systems on a global scale, hence requiring the implementation of inventive strategies to identify and mitigate age-related illnesses at an early stage. The primary objective of this study is to explore the use of big data analytics to improve healthcare practices.
